Understanding CSGO matchmaking begins with grasping how player rankings are determined within the game. The ranking system is primarily based on a player's performance in competitive matches, which includes several factors such as wins, losses, and kills. Each player is assigned a rank typically categorized from Silver to Global Elite. The central idea is that as players improve and consistently win matches against similarly ranked opponents, they can ascend to higher ranks. This is crucial for maintaining a balanced matchmaking experience and ensuring that players face opponents of comparable skill levels.
Another key aspect of the ranking system is the Matchmaking Rating (MMR), which quantifies a player's skill level through an algorithm that considers performance metrics. This includes not only victory or defeat but also individual contributions, like deaths, assists, and overall effectiveness in-game. It's important to note that players may experience fluctuations in their rank due to the dynamic nature of matchmaking, where the system continuously adjusts rankings based on performance in real-time. This means that a well-rounded understanding of both personal improvement and the ranking system is vital for players aspiring to climb the ranks in CSGO.

Climbing the ranks in CS:GO requires more than just gameplay skills; it demands a strategic approach to improve your overall performance. First and foremost, players should focus on mastering the fundamentals, including aim and positioning. Engaging in dedicated aim training through maps like aim_lab or aim_tec can significantly enhance your precision. Additionally, understanding the game's mechanics, such as weapon spray patterns and eco-round strategies, can lead to better decision-making during matches.
Another critical aspect of improving your CS:GO rank is effective communication with your team. Utilize in-game voice chat or text chat to relay important information, like enemy positions and strategy updates. Furthermore, consider developing a pre-match routine that includes reviewing past games, identifying mistakes, and setting specific goals for improvement. By focusing on these strategies, you can steadily ascend the competitive ladder and achieve that coveted global elite status.
In the world of CSGO rankings, there are numerous myths that can mislead players into making incorrect assumptions about their skills and game performance. One common misconception is that rank reflects skill level solely based on win-loss ratios. While victories do play a part, CSGO rankings evaluate various factors, including individual performance metrics like kill/death ratio, MVPs, and damage per round. Relying too heavily on win-loss records can skew a player's perception of their true abilities.
Another prevalent myth is that playing with higher-ranked players guarantees a faster climb up the rankings. While teaming up with skilled players can enhance your gameplay and provide valuable lessons, it doesn't automatically translate to improved CSGO rankings. In fact, mismatched ranks can lead to frustration and poor performance, as you may find yourself struggling to keep up with the pace of the game or the strategies being employed. Instead, it’s essential to focus on personal improvement and understanding game mechanics to genuinely elevate your ranking.
